Вход | Регистрация
 

Можно ли сделать гиперссылку в ячейке MXL, чтобы она в XLS сохранялась как гиперссылка?

Можно ли сделать гиперссылку в ячейке MXL, чтобы она в XLS сохранялась как гиперссылка?
Я
   Гений 1С
 
11.05.21 - 11:49
Устанавливаю Гиперссылка = истина, не помогает....
В Экселе синим не подсвечивает.
   ДенисЧ
 
1 - 11.05.21 - 11:49
Нет
   ДенисЧ
 
2 - 11.05.21 - 11:50
Имеется в виду - штатно, средствами только 1с
   Гений 1С
 
3 - 11.05.21 - 11:51
(1) сукко, придется в экселе ковырять.
   Гений 1С
 
4 - 11.05.21 - 11:51
вот вам и MXL
   Гений 1С
 
5 - 11.05.21 - 11:55
что-то не верится. Ведь во всех прайсах есть гиперсссылка. Неужто 1С "прошляпила"?
   Гений 1С
 
6 - 11.05.21 - 12:10
гы, че то не я первый обломился: https://pro1c.org.ua/index.php?showtopic=1434
   Garykom
 
7 - 11.05.21 - 12:12
(0) Нет и не надо. Используйте веб-технологии вместо древних извратов через ексель
   Гений 1С
 
8 - 11.05.21 - 12:14
(7) что за мода пренебрегать пожеланиями клиентов. Типа счас прайсы никто не использует.
ого, пожелание в 1С записано аж в 2011 году, 10 лет назад.
   Kassern
 
9 - 11.05.21 - 12:15
(0) берете ком и ваяйте ячейки нужного формата со всеми возможностями екселя. Хоть формулы рисуйте, а вообще, если через 1с сохранить в xlsx url в отдельную колонку, то при двойном щелчке по урлу в екселе, он сам определит, что это ссылка и подсветит.
   Kassern
 
10 - 11.05.21 - 12:16
(9) по крайней мере 2010 эксель это делает
   Гений 1С
 
11 - 11.05.21 - 12:18
Опа, нашел от Ненавижна ту же проблему, как раз в 2010м году: v8: Гиперссылка в области табличного документа
(9) спасибо КЭП
   Garykom
 
12 - 11.05.21 - 12:20
(8) Клиент может пожелать .CAL и что?
Твое дело предложить клиенту лучший вариант за его деньги
   Garykom
 
13 - 11.05.21 - 12:21
(12)+ На данный момент стандарт для печатаемых файлов это PDF
Для просматриваемых HTML
HTML можно сделать как оффлайновый так и онлайновый что сильно лучше
   pechkin
 
14 - 11.05.21 - 12:21
(12) а какой вариант лучше, если клиенту нужен прайс лист офлайн?
   Garykom
 
15 - 11.05.21 - 12:21
(13)+ И да браузер у клиента 100% есть, в отличие от офиса
   Garykom
 
16 - 11.05.21 - 12:22
(14) HTML
   pechkin
 
17 - 11.05.21 - 12:23
(16) с фильтрами и сортировками?
те свой эксель рисовать?
   Garykom
 
18 - 11.05.21 - 12:23
(16)+ даже картинки можно внутрь если уж очень хочется
https://webo.in/articles/habrahabr/29-all-about-data-url-images/
   Garykom
 
19 - 11.05.21 - 12:23
(17) Кнопочка "Экспорт"
   Garykom
 
20 - 11.05.21 - 12:23
(17) Хотя простые фильтры и сортировки на JS банально
   pechkin
 
21 - 11.05.21 - 12:24
(19) экспорт в ексель? те пришли откуда ушли
   Garykom
 
22 - 11.05.21 - 12:25
(21) Не в эксель а csv, который клиент может открыть чем хочет
хоть Libre хоть онлайн офисом
   pechkin
 
23 - 11.05.21 - 12:26
(22) но в там ссылок то не будет
   pechkin
 
24 - 11.05.21 - 12:26
те ссылки смотри в браузере, а фильтры ставь в екселе
   Garykom
 
25 - 11.05.21 - 12:27
(23) Будут ссылки в виде текстовых полей, как их преобразует софт ("офис") юзера это другой вопрос
   Garykom
 
26 - 11.05.21 - 12:28
(24) Есть готовый гуглодокс и прочие. Даже яндекс свой офис сделал
   Ненавижу 1С
 
27 - 11.05.21 - 12:28
можно и HTML, но полный сценарий такой - клиенту высылается прайс, туда клиент вносит данные по количеству (сразу видит суммы, скидки) и отправляет для заказа обратно этот файл
как в HTML сохранить данные количества?
да есть клиенты у которых нет интернета по тем или иным причинам
   Гений 1С
 
28 - 11.05.21 - 12:30
(27) вот-вот, че только не придумают некоторые исполнители, чтобы прогнуть клиента под свою лень. Ты это, скинь код по добавлению гиперссылок, если остался.
   Garykom
 
29 - 11.05.21 - 12:33
(27) Ты логику понимаешь?
Зачем клиенту высылать прайс, а потом получать назад когда можно просто выслать ему адрес сайта и логин с паролем?
И пусть он в веб-клиенте заказа (сайте) смотрит цены и делает заказы, которые будут сразу сыпаться в базу 1С
   Kassern
 
30 - 11.05.21 - 12:34
(28) нда...просите человека скинуть код, который он писал под себя 11лет назад и еще что-то про лень пишете. Там 10 строчек кода, написать быстрее чем найти.
 
 
   Garykom
 
31 - 11.05.21 - 12:34
(27) >да есть клиенты у которых нет интернета по тем или иным причинам
Прайс в екселе им как? На флешках или cd дисках?
   Ненавижу 1С
 
32 - 11.05.21 - 12:37
(31) по разному. Но многим торгпреды привозят или вместе заполняют. Или интернет есть но только дома
   Kassern
 
33 - 11.05.21 - 12:42
(29) у меня так реализовано на одном из проектов. Торгпреды ездят с планшетами и вместе с клиентом составляют заказ. Благо с инетом особой проблемы нет.
   Гений 1С
 
34 - 11.05.21 - 13:05
(29) открою для тебя Америку:
1. Не все клиенты используют прайсы для заказов.
2. Подъем сервиса для заказов стоит денег.

Т.е. ты предлагаешь поломать текущий процесс и срубить бабло на новый. Не норм, конечно, но "мечтатель" детектед
   trdm
 
35 - 11.05.21 - 13:06
(28) там делать нечего, обходишь ячейки листа и:
                вСтрДиап = НазваниеСтолбца(СчКолонок)+Строка(СчРядов);
                вСтрДиап = вСтрДиап + ":"+вСтрДиап;
                вЛистХЛС.Hyperlinks.Add(вЛистХЛС.Range(вСтрДиап),Зн1С);
                ЯЧейка1 = вЛистХЛС.Cells(СчРядов,СчКолонок);
                Если вЛогироватьПреобраз = 1 Тогда
                    записатьВлогПреобразований(""+Адр+"; Зн1С = '"+Зн1С+"' >> Hyperlinks.Add" );
                КонецЕсли;                 
                ЯЧейка1.Value = "Подробное описание";
   trdm
 
36 - 11.05.21 - 13:09
(35) где Зн1С = ЯЧейка1.Value
   Ненавижу 1С
 
37 - 11.05.21 - 13:09
Ячейка = Лист.Cells(Строка, й0);
Ячейка.Hyperlinks.Add(Ячейка, ГиперСсылка);
   Гений 1С
 
38 - 11.05.21 - 13:58
(35) (37) не, я думал есть решение, которое ячейки с текстом HTTPS находит. Все ячейки долго обходить
но в принципе, можно набростаь.
   trdm
 
39 - 11.05.21 - 14:09
(38) у тебя что рандомные отчеты? наверняка гиперссылки сидят в определенной колонке/колонках. всегда есть возможность оптимизадницы.
   Гений 1С
 
40 - 11.05.21 - 14:25
(39) возможно, возможно, канешн... но проще универсальную замену написать, чтобы не искать ячейки с сцылками.


Список тем форума
 
ВНИМАНИЕ! Если вы потеряли окно ввода сообщения, нажмите Ctrl-F5 или Ctrl-R или кнопку "Обновить" в браузере.